Finance Manager – Liverpool, up to £55,000 + Benefits

We are seeking an experienced and commercially minded Finance Manager to join a successful and expanding real estate group based in Liverpool. With a varied portfolio of schemes across the UK and overseas and an annual turnover of approximately £7 million, this is a pivotal role offering significant responsibility and influence within the business.

Reporting directly to the Directors, you will take ownership of the company's finance function, providing robust financial management, strategic insight, and operational support to drive continued growth.

Key Responsibilities

  • Full responsibility for the day-to-day finance function of the business
  • Production of monthly management accounts and financial reporting packs
  • Preparation, monitoring, and management of annual budgets and forecasts
  • Cash flow management and liquidity planning across multiple property developments
  • Financial oversight of active schemes located both in the UK and internationally
  • Preparation, management and reconciliation of service charge budgets and accounts
  • Monitoring service charge expenditure and ensuring accurate recovery from tenants and occupiers
  • Production of year-end service charge reconciliations and liaison with managing agents, surveyors and auditors
  • Ensuring compliance with relevant property accounting regulations and service charge legislation
  • Variance analysis and provision of commercial recommendations to senior leadership
  • Management of balance sheet reconciliations and month-end processes
  • Oversight of accounts payable, accounts receivable, and general ledger activities
  • Liaison with external accountants, auditors, tax advisers, banks, managing agents and stakeholders
  • Ensuring compliance with statutory, regulatory, and tax obligations
  • Monitoring project profitability, development costs, and investment performance
  • Supporting strategic decision-making through financial modelling and analysis
  • Identifying and implementing improvements to financial systems, controls, and processes

It is essential you are a fully qualified accountant with previous and experience within property, real estate, construction, development, or asset management environments is highly desirable.
